OpenFOAM Configuration
The main OpenFOAM settings are located in the parent etc/ directory.
Both POSIX (bash, dash,...) and csh shells are supported.
To configure OpenFOAM, source either the etc/bashrc or the
etc/cshrc file, as appropriate for your shell.
These source the following files in the config.sh/ or
config.csh/ directories:

The config.*/example directories contain additional example configuration
files for the corresponding shell:
